Lenomyrmex of Costa Rica

Lenomyrmex is a small genus of rare ants known from Ecuador, Colombia, and Panama (Fernandez 2001, Fernandez and Palacio 1999), and an undescribed species has recently been collected in Costa Rica. There are only five described species, all known from very few or single specimens. They have all been collected in wet forest habitats, from sea level to mid-elevation montane forest. They have been collected by manual search and in Berlese and Winkler samples from the forest floor.
